Machine Learning Engineer

Job description

About Arthur:

At Arthur, we are deeply passionate about building technology to make AI understandable, effective, and fair. Arthur makes machine learning work for enterprises through performance monitoring, explainability, and bias detection. We’re built by AI experts and backed by world-class, diverse investors.

This position is a rare (and fun!) opportunity to help shape the future of AI and its real-world impact. We are an equal opportunity employer and believe strongly in front-end ethics: building a company and industry where strong performance and a positive human impact are inextricably linked. 

About the role

Arthur is looking for multiple product-focused Machine Learning Engineers to join our team, to operate with autonomy and with the support of the team to lead and build out our product vision.

What you'll do

  • Focus on ML, especially LLMs, model performance, security, and robustness: make LLM and model-based systems respond accurately, quickly, and comprehensively to general and task-specific interactions by both natural and adversarial users – for example, checking veracity of responses, hardening against prompt injection, query-based routing to different models, and generation of evaluation datasets
  • Build out new techniques and tooling in ML model monitoring: data drift detection, high-dimensional density estimation, time series anomaly detection; detection and mitigation of issues in fairness and bias in ML algorithms
  • Identify, create, and deploy large-scale explainability methods for tabular, image, text, and other data – including human-centered explanations for generative AI applications
  • Run machine learning experiments independently and in collaboration with product and research teams, and communicate results to internal stakeholders as well as the broader ML community via publications in top-tier conferences, industry conference presentations, deep technical blogs, and events

What we're looking for

  • 3-5+ years of professional experience in Machine Learning, or in Engineering providing strong ML support, or in Data Science/Statistics with very strong Engineering expertise
  • Experience with deploying ML models to production and with comprehensive model risk management
  • Deep interest in LLMs (to start) and multimodal generative models (soon!), specifically around measuring bias or performance
  • Enthusiasm for staying up to date on the latest developments in the field – we operate in a nascent space with plenty of signal and plenty of noise coming from arXiv and open source projects
  • Understanding of software engineering best practices, version control, and containerization
  • Experience with deep learning frameworks, such as JAX, Tensorflow, or PyTorch, in addition to deep experience writing production-grade Python
  • Knowledge of and ability to (re)learn statistical methods and contemporary ML algorithms
  • Customer empathy and a willingness to engage directly with customers and stakeholders
  • Experience with public cloud services, such as AWS, Google Cloud, or Azure

You might also have (nice to have)

  • Experience or interest in interactive machine learning, HCI, human-centered ML and LLM evaluation, etc.
  • Experience or interest in explainability and fairness of recommender systems
  • A body of ML-focused publications (we tend to have a presence at NeurIPS/ICML, KDD, AAAI, CHI, and the newer responsible AI conferences like SaTML, FAccT, and AIES), technical blogging, and/or open source projects
  • A Masters or PhD in a quantitative field – we’re not sticklers for degrees (many of us have Masters/PhDs, so we intimately understand this isn’t the only way to be a domain expert)

What to expect at Arthur

  • Teammates who value curiosity, hard work, collaboration, and creative problem-solving -- and good swag
  • A team of professionals who are passionate about our work and making a positive impact through AI
  • A caring culture; we value and prioritize our team’s physical and mental health, encouraging and celebrating life outside of work
  • Autonomy to pursue your role and interests with room to grow, with a team behind you that always has your back
  • Joy, humor, and a little dose of healthy competition (in our business, we win as a team; on company game night, may the best Arthurian win…)

We offer

  • Competitive compensation plus medical, dental, and vision insurance, and a 401K (with matching)
    • Our target base salary range for this role is $160,000 - $230,000, based on your experience and how your skills align with role requirements
  • Equity in what we’re building together, backed by some of the most respected VCs in the industry
  • A flexible learning and development budget: we’ll support ways to learn and grow in the areas that matter to you
  • Highly discounted wellness and fitness benefits
  • Flexible PTO with vacation minimums, which we really want you to take and enjoy
  • The ability to work in a highly flexible hybrid environment with our team from home, and from our NYC office

***

Arthur is an equal-opportunity employer; we believe strongly in front-end ethics: building a company and industry where strong performance and a positive human impact are inextricably linked. This reflects in our desire and commitment to build teams that comprise different backgrounds and experiences. Arthur provides equal employment opportunities to all employees and applicants for employment and prohibits discrimination and harassment of any type without regard to race, color, religion, age, sex, national origin, disability status, genetics, protected veteran status, sexual orientation, gender identity or expression, or any other characteristic protected by federal, state or local laws.

View in org chart

Open roles at Arthur AI

Two candidates
The Org
helps you hire
great candidates
It takes less than ten minutes to set up your company page.
It’s free to use - try it out today.